    Canbus is the networking system used to communicate between modules, send signals, the speakers arent part of this system & are either wired from the head unit or amp in the boot.

    You would need to take a door card of & test for fitting as it may well require an mdf bracket or the like, you'd need to pop radio out & check wiring to the speaker outputs to see what yours are spec'd for.
